Output 68abce10a3f92c3f9b04bcaa72f8f665bf90810491cae3e66f7faaae08e37baa:7

value
60899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26eeb4b16148a2b0d89be96b75fda2a55ebb32eb OP_EQUAL
address
35EsZQTXcuqqnwM1TiiVoKccxGeMMFineF
transaction
68abce10a3f92c3f9b04bcaa72f8f665bf90810491cae3e66f7faaae08e37baa
confirmations
250151
spent
true